- Military Service - 1899-1902
http://www.britishmedals.us/files/127dmr.htm
This is the nominal roll of the District Mounted Rifles, a colonial unit of the Boer War of 1899-1902. The index was compiled from WO 127 at the National Archives, Kew. The index is in an A-Z form and in the following order.
Pote Cecil Denison St. Clair Cpl. 390
